Trend #1: AI-Powered Automation in Workplaces:
AI-driven
automation is transforming businesses by streamlining workflows, reducing
costs, and increasing efficiency. Companies are adopting AI for various
tasks, from customer service to supply chain management, making AI-powered
productivity a game changer.
Key Developments:
· AI
Chatbots & Virtual Assistants: Enhanced AI-powered customer service solutions, improving
user engagement.
·
AI-Driven HR &
Recruitment: Automating
hiring processes with AI-powered resume screening and candidate assessment.
· AI in Manufacturing: Predictive maintenance, AI-driven
robotics, and automated quality control.
Impact on Industries:
Industry |
AI Automation
Applications |
Retail |
Smart inventory management, personalized AI-driven
recommendations |
Finance |
AI fraud detection, algorithmic trading, AI-driven
risk analysis |
Healthcare |
AI-powered diagnostics, robotic surgery, AI-enhanced
patient care |
Trend #2: Ethical AI and Responsible Development:
As AI
becomes more powerful, ethical considerations are gaining importance.
Organizations are now prioritizing fairness, transparency, and
accountability in AI development to ensure trust and reliability.
Key Focus Areas:
·
Bias Reduction: AI algorithms must be free from
racial, gender, or economic biases to ensure fair outcomes.
·
Regulations
and Governance: Global
AI laws are being enforced to ensure responsible use and prevent misuse of AI
technology.
·
AI
Transparency: Businesses
are now required to disclose AI decision-making processes, fostering trust and
accountability.
Why It Matters:
Companies
that prioritize ethical AI gain user trust, regulatory approval, and a
competitive edge in the market, making this a crucial trend for sustainable AI
development.
Trend #3: AI in Healthcare and Drug Discovery:
The
healthcare industry is leveraging AI for faster diagnoses, personalized
treatment, and drug discovery. AI-driven tools are proving essential for
improving patient outcomes and streamlining medical research.
Breakthrough Innovations:
·
AI-Powered
Medical Imaging: Early
detection of diseases like cancer and Alzheimer's using AI-enhanced
diagnostics.
·
AI
in Drug Discovery: Reducing
the time required for new drug development through AI-driven molecular
analysis.
· Telemedicine AI Assistants:
Providing real-time
consultations, AI-driven diagnostics, and remote patient monitoring.
Example:
AI has
helped pharmaceutical companies develop vaccines and treatments at an
unprecedented speed, revolutionizing the healthcare industry by reducing
research timelines and increasing treatment effectiveness.
Trend #4: Generative AI and Content Creation:
The rise of Generative
AI has transformed content creation, enabling the generation of text,
images, videos, and music with remarkable accuracy, making it a key driver
in digital transformation.
Applications of Generative AI:
·
AI-Written
Content: AI-powered
tools like ChatGPT generate news articles, blogs, and even books, enhancing
content marketing strategies.
·
AI-Generated
Art: Tools like Midjourney and DALL·E
create stunning visual art for designers and digital creators.
· AI-Powered Video Creation: AI can generate realistic deepfake
videos, AI-enhanced animations, and automated video editing tools for creators.
With these advancements,
content creators and businesses are integrating AI-generated content
into their daily workflows, boosting efficiency and creativity.
Trend #5: AI in Cybersecurity and Fraud Detection:
Cybersecurity
threats are evolving, and AI is stepping up to counteract these risks.
AI-driven security solutions are detecting and preventing cyberattacks more
efficiently than ever, ensuring robust AI-driven security solutions.
Key Security Advancements:
AI-Powered Threat Detection: Identifying and mitigating cyber threats in real time through advanced machine learning algorithms.
·
Fraud
Prevention: Banks and
financial institutions are using AI to detect fraudulent transactions and
prevent financial crimes.
· Biometric
Security: AI-driven
facial recognition, fingerprint scanning, and voice authentication enhance
security and identity verification.
Impact:
Organizations that integrate AI-powered security solutions experience fewer breaches, improved data protection, and enhanced cybersecurity resilience against emerging threats.
FAQs
1 . How
is AI shaping the job market in 2025?
AI is automating repetitive tasks, but it is also creating
new job opportunities in AI ethics, AI development, and AI integration roles,
driving innovation and employment growth.
2 . What
industries will be most impacted by AI trends in 2025?
Industries such as healthcare, finance, retail,
cybersecurity, content creation, and manufacturing will see significant AI
advancements.
3 . Will
AI completely replace human creativity?
No, AI enhances creativity by generating ideas and automating
repetitive tasks, but human ingenuity is still essential for originality and
emotional depth in content creation.
4 . How
can businesses implement AI responsibly?
Businesses should follow ethical AI guidelines,
conduct regular bias assessments, ensure transparency, and comply with AI
regulations to maintain trust and fairness.
5 . Is
AI-generated content reliable?
While AI-generated content is impressive, human oversight is
necessary to ensure accuracy, credibility, and ethical considerations in
content creation.
6 . What
are the risks of AI in cybersecurity?
AI can be used for both security and cyberattacks. Ethical AI
development, AI governance, and proactive AI threat detection are crucial to
prevent misuse and enhance cybersecurity.
